Description

Martin Aquatic is seeking a Designer to join our Creative Studio with a strong focus on layout design for a wide range of aquatic projects, including indoor and outdoor waterparks, aquatic resort amenities, and thematic aquatic spaces. This position plays a key role in developing visual layouts for client presentations, showcasing various elements of site design. We’re looking for someone who can interpret client needs and conceptual ideas into 2D AutoCAD layouts and help finalize those into visually appealing plans. This role also includes producing supporting documentation such as capacity models, guest circulation diagrams, aquatic element identification plans, and furniture plans. While the primary responsibility is CAD-based, experience with Adobe tools is highly preferred, as the role will also support the team with design deliverables such as presentations and booklets.
We’re looking for a team player who can work efficiently in AutoCAD, is detail-oriented, and comfortable shifting into Adobe tasks as needed.
This is a full-time, on-site role based in our collaborative downtown Orlando office, working on projects located throughout the U.S. and internationally.

Responsibilities
  • Creating initial bubble plans for early conceptual development
  • Utilizing AutoCAD to design creatively driven, aquatic-focused site layouts while following required building and health codes
  • Developing supporting site plans to provide design context, including guest circulation diagrams, seating layouts, furniture plans, and back-of-house layouts
  • Support the design team by generating visual presentation materials in InDesign, Illustrator, and Photoshop
  • Sourcing and organizing reference imagery to support project concept development
